A weekly podcast: Join Dave Pickering on his journey to get better acquainted with the people he knows. Part interview show, part oral history project and part autobiography through conversation.British Podcast Award 2017 winner (bronze in Best Interview category)GBA was nominated for a 2012 Radio Production Award, aired for 3 seasons on Resonance 104.4 FM and was featured on BBC Radio 4's In Pod We Trust, BBC Radio 5 Lives Helen and Olly's Required Listening and has been recommended by The Guardian, Time Out and the Financial Times

    In GBA 34 we get better acquainted with both Eric and my father. It's late at night after dinner and we’ve had a few drinks, so we also get better acquainted with me as I talk more than usual. We talk about their friendship (which is older than me), the effects and interactions of one generation on another, Eric and my Dad’s short but very interesting experiences in teaching and Eric’s big theory on how class is experienced in modern Britain.
